The European Interoperability Framework underlying principles view is the view of the European Interoperability Reference Architecture for the Interoperability principles of the European Interoperability Framework. It models the motivation of the EIRA© in terms of goals to be achieved and principles to be followed in order to achieve interoperability in public services.


The interoperability principles are fundamental behavioural aspects to drive interoperable public services. They describe the context in which European public services are designed and implemented.
They are grouped into four categories:

  1. A principle setting the context for EU actions on interoperability: #eif1p - Subsidiarity and proportionality;
  2. Core interoperability principles: #eif2p - Openness, #eif3p - Transparency, #eif4p - Reusability and #eif5p - Technological neutrality and data portability;
  3. Principles related to generic user needs and expectations: #eif6p - User-centricity, #eif7p - Inclusion and accessibility, #eif8p - Security and privacy and #eif9p - Multilingualism;
  4. Foundation principles for cooperation among public administrations: #eif10p - Administrative simplification, #eif11p - Preservation of information and #eif12p - Assessment of effectiveness and efficiency.

Narrative

The twelve interoperability principles of the EIF ([Subsidiarity and proportionality], [Openness], [Transparency], [Transparency], [Technological neutrality and data portability], [User-centricity], [Inclusion and accessibility], [Security and privacy], [Multilingualism], [Administrative simplification], [Preservation of information] and [Assessment of Effectiveness and Efficiency])

together fulfil the goals of achieving interoperability:

  • [Achieve Legal Interoperability],
  • [Achieve Organisational Interoperability],
  • [Achieve Semantic Interoperability] and
  • [Achieve Technical Interoperability].
